Background
Ruvinsky, Anatoly was born on July 24, 1947 in Berlin. Arrived in Australia, 1993. Son of Ovsey and Dina (Shulman) Ruvinsky.

Within the past two decades, new methods created by molecular genetics and cytogenetics as well as quantitative genetics have greatly enlarged the amount and quality of genetic information available in domestic mammals. Cattle have been significantly involved in this process, particularly due to the large impact of new knowledge and methods on the economy and culture of numerous countries for both meat and milk production. As demands for these goods increase, modern genetic technologies in immunogenetics, cytogenetics, biochemical and molecular genetics create optimistic expectations for the future. A comprehensive reference to work on genetics and selection of cattle Written by internationally recognized experts All relevant topics, from phylogeny, morphological traits, diseases and behavior to transgenics, performance traits and genome mapping included Invaluable to advanced students and researchers, as well as livestock producers and veterinarians.

Genomics has experienced a dramatic development during the last 15-20 years. Data from mammalian genomes such as the human, mouse and rat have already been published, while others such as the dog, cattle and chimpanzee will soon follow. This book summarizes the current knowledge of mammalian genomics and offers a comparative analysis of genomes known today. This analysis includes farm, companion and lab animals. Topics covered include structural and functional aspects of the mammalian genome, mechanisms of genomic changes at the molecular level, evolution of DNA sequences, comparative chromosome mapping and painting, genome databases, gene prediction and the use of genomic information to understand inherited diseases. Contributors include leading researchers from Europe, USA, Australia and Japan.

The theory and application of mammalian genetics have evolved rapidly over the last two decades to include immunogenetics and molecular genetics, creating fresh insights into biological processes. These developments, together with improved management practices, have revolutionized pig production. This book is a comprehensive reference work on pig genetics and its integration with livestock management and production technology to improve performance. All relevant topics have been included, from phylogeny, morphological traits, diseases and behavior to transgenics, performance traits, genetic conservation and genome mapping. Linkage maps and the latest list of identified loci are included. Chapters have been specially commissioned for the volume by internationally recognized experts from Europe, North America and Australia. The book will be invaluable to advanced students and research workers in all branches of animal genetics and breeding, livestock producers and veterinarians.

During the last two decades, major advances have been made in mammalian genetics. New methods in molecular and cytogenetics, and in biotechnology have been developed. Many of these have been applied to investigating the genetics of sheep and to improving the production of wool, meat and milk. This book is a comprehensive reference work on sheep genetics. All relevant topics have been included, from fundamental genetic structure to the genetics of various production and other traits, to transgenic sheep and genetic conservation. Chapters have been specially commissioned for the volume and written by internationally recognized experts from Europe, USA, Australia and New Zealand. The book will be invaluable to advanced students and research workers in animal genetics, breeding and biotechnology.

Ruvinsky, Anatoly was born on July 24, 1947 in Berlin. Arrived in Australia, 1993. Son of Ovsey and Dina (Shulman) Ruvinsky.
Master of Science, Novosibirsk (Union of the Soviet Socialist Republics) State University, 1969. Doctor of Philosophy in Genetics, Union of the Soviet Socialist Republics Academy of Sciences, Novosibirsk, 1974. Doctor of Science, High Attestation Committee, Moscow, 1985.
Prof Genetics and Cytology (honorary), Ministry High Education, Moscow, 1989.
Researcher Institute Cytology and Genetics,, Union of the Soviet Socialist Republics Academy Sciences, 1973-1985; head laboratory, Union of the Soviet Socialist Republics Academy Sciences, 1986-1992; vice director Institute, Union of the Soviet Socialist Republics Academy Sciences, 1988-1992; associate professor genetics and biology, U. New England, Armidale, NSW., Australia, since 1993. Professor Novosibirsk State University, 1985-1992.

Member International Mammalian Genome Society, Genetics Society Australia, Vavilov's Genetic Society (vice president Siberian branch 1979-1992, Vavilov's medal 1987), Genetics Society of America, New York Academy of Sciences.
Married Ludmila Ilina, March 7, 1968. Children: Ilya, Svetlana.
